## Problem

When reviewing a session's Changes (diff) view and leaving comments — including unresolved comments and back-and-forth conversations with the LLM — there's no quick way to jump between them. I end up scrolling up and down the diff hunting for my open threads, which gets painful on larger changes.

## Proposed feature

Add explicit **Previous / Next comment** navigation in the Changes / diff UI. Ideally:

- Visible UX affordance (e.g., up/down arrow buttons in a small floating control, or buttons in the file header) — there appears to be room for it.
- Jumps between all comment threads in the current diff (or scoped to unresolved / open threads).
- Keyboard shortcuts as well (e.g., `j`/`k` or `n`/`p`). If these already exist, they're not discoverable — surfacing them in the UI would help.
- Bonus: a small counter like `2 of 7` so you know where you are in the list of threads.

## Why it matters

- Reviewing my own comments and the LLM's responses is a core part of the iteration loop.
- Scrolling to find threads breaks flow, especially when a session has produced a large diff.
- Discoverable Prev/Next controls make the review surface feel much more like a real code review tool.
